By profession Maartje van Eerd is a Human Geographer with extensive experience as a researcher, trainer, and advisor on housing and social development issues. Her PhD research focused on the governance aspects of resettlement in Chennai, India, where she currently coordinates a research project on interventions to improve access to (digital) information and the livelihoods of underprivileged  women and their families. Through this experience in Chennai, she has fostered a collaboration with local institute Anna University, which has led to the recent production of a documentary on the gender impact of housing resettlements. Van Eerd also conducts training and advisory work in the Global South, particularly in South and Southeast Asia, as well as Africa.  Her primary research interest and expertise lie on housing rights, displacement, and resettlement.
